Since you are a WatchGuard shop, did you heed their Thursday advice to patch your devices?
This email is to inform you that the updated Firebox firmware, which addresses multiple, previously disclosed but unexploited critical security vulnerabilities, is now available. Please update all owned, managed, and client-operated devices immediately.
The following new versions are now available to download from the WatchGuard Software Downloads Center, WatchGuard Cloud, or the Firebox Web UI. You should immediately update your Firebox appliance(s) to one of these versions or higher (if available):
• Fireware 2026.2.2
• Fireware v12.12.2
• Fireware v12.5.20
